Share via


Microsoft.AVS privateClouds 2020-03-20

Bicep-resursdefinition

Resurstypen privateClouds kan distribueras med åtgärder som mål:

En lista över ändrade egenskaper i varje API-version finns i ändringsloggen.

Resursformat

Om du vill skapa en Microsoft.AVS/privateClouds-resurs lägger du till följande Bicep i mallen.

resource symbolicname 'Microsoft.AVS/privateClouds@2020-03-20' = {
  name: 'string'
  location: 'string'
  tags: {
    tagName1: 'tagValue1'
    tagName2: 'tagValue2'
  }
  sku: {
    name: 'string'
  }
  properties: {
    circuit: {}
    identitySources: [
      {
        alias: 'string'
        baseGroupDN: 'string'
        baseUserDN: 'string'
        domain: 'string'
        name: 'string'
        password: 'string'
        primaryServer: 'string'
        secondaryServer: 'string'
        ssl: 'string'
        username: 'string'
      }
    ]
    internet: 'string'
    managementCluster: {
      clusterSize: int
    }
    networkBlock: 'string'
    nsxtPassword: 'string'
    vcenterPassword: 'string'
  }
}

Egenskapsvärden

privateClouds

Namn Beskrivning Värde
name Resursnamnet sträng (krävs)
location Resursplats sträng
tags Resurstaggar Ordlista med taggnamn och värden. Se Taggar i mallar
sku SKU:n för privata moln Sku (krävs)
properties Egenskaperna för en privat molnresurs PrivateCloudProperties (krävs)

PrivateCloudEgenskaper

Namn Beskrivning Värde
Krets En ExpressRoute-krets Krets
identitySources vCenter Enkel inloggning identitetskällor IdentitySource[]
Internet Anslutningen till Internet är aktiverad eller inaktiverad "Inaktiverad"
"Aktiverad"
managementCluster Standardklustret som används för hantering ManagementCluster
networkBlock Adressblocket ska vara unikt mellan virtuella nätverk i din prenumeration och lokalt. Kontrollera att CIDR-formatet överensstämmer med (A.B.C.D/X) där A,B,C,D är mellan 0 och 255 och X är mellan 0 och 22 sträng (krävs)
nsxtPassword Du kan också ange NSX-T Manager-lösenordet när det privata molnet skapas sträng
vcenterPassword Du kan också ange vCenter-administratörslösenordet när det privata molnet skapas sträng

Krets

Det här objektet innehåller inga egenskaper som ska anges under distributionen. Alla egenskaper är ReadOnly.

IdentitySource

Namn Beskrivning Värde
alias Domänens NetBIOS-namn sträng
baseGroupDN Det unika basnamnet för grupper sträng
baseUserDN Det unika basnamnet för användare sträng
domän Domänens dns-namn sträng
name Namnet på identitetskällan sträng
password Lösenordet för Active Directory-användaren med minst skrivskyddad åtkomst till Base DN för användare och grupper. sträng
primaryServer Primär server-URL sträng
secondaryServer Sekundär server-URL sträng
Ssl Skydda LDAP-kommunikation med SSL-certifikat (LDAPS) "Inaktiverad"
"Aktiverad"
användarnamn ID för en Active Directory-användare med minst skrivskyddad åtkomst till bas-DN för användare och grupper sträng

ManagementCluster

Namn Beskrivning Värde
clusterSize Klusterstorleken int

Sku

Namn Beskrivning Värde
name Namnet på SKU:n. sträng (krävs)

Resursdefinition för ARM-mall

Resurstypen privateClouds kan distribueras med åtgärder som är mål:

En lista över ändrade egenskaper i varje API-version finns i ändringsloggen.

Resursformat

Om du vill skapa en Microsoft.AVS/privateClouds-resurs lägger du till följande JSON i mallen.

{
  "type": "Microsoft.AVS/privateClouds",
  "apiVersion": "2020-03-20",
  "name": "string",
  "location": "string",
  "tags": {
    "tagName1": "tagValue1",
    "tagName2": "tagValue2"
  },
  "sku": {
    "name": "string"
  },
  "properties": {
    "circuit": {},
    "identitySources": [
      {
        "alias": "string",
        "baseGroupDN": "string",
        "baseUserDN": "string",
        "domain": "string",
        "name": "string",
        "password": "string",
        "primaryServer": "string",
        "secondaryServer": "string",
        "ssl": "string",
        "username": "string"
      }
    ],
    "internet": "string",
    "managementCluster": {
      "clusterSize": "int"
    },
    "networkBlock": "string",
    "nsxtPassword": "string",
    "vcenterPassword": "string"
  }
}

Egenskapsvärden

privateClouds

Namn Beskrivning Värde
typ Resurstypen "Microsoft.AVS/privateClouds"
apiVersion Resurs-API-versionen '2020-03-20'
name Resursnamnet sträng (krävs)
location Resursplats sträng
tags Resurstaggar Ordlista med taggnamn och värden. Se Taggar i mallar
sku SKU:n för privata moln SKU (krävs)
properties Egenskaperna för en privat molnresurs PrivateCloudProperties (krävs)

PrivateCloudProperties

Namn Beskrivning Värde
Krets En ExpressRoute-krets Krets
identitySources vCenter Enkel inloggning identitetskällor IdentitySource[]
Internet Anslutning till Internet är aktiverad eller inaktiverad "Inaktiverad"
"Aktiverad"
managementCluster Standardklustret som används för hantering ManagementCluster
networkBlock Adressblocket ska vara unikt för det virtuella nätverket i din prenumeration och lokalt. Kontrollera att CIDR-formatet överensstämmer med (A.B.C.D/X) där A,B,C,D är mellan 0 och 255 och X är mellan 0 och 22 sträng (krävs)
nsxtPassword Du kan också ange NSX-T Manager-lösenordet när det privata molnet skapas sträng
vcenterPassword Du kan också ange vCenter-administratörslösenordet när det privata molnet skapas sträng

Krets

Det här objektet innehåller inga egenskaper som ska anges under distributionen. Alla egenskaper är ReadOnly.

IdentitySource

Namn Beskrivning Värde
alias Domänens NetBIOS-namn sträng
baseGroupDN Det unika basnamnet för grupper sträng
baseUserDN Det unika basnamnet för användare sträng
domän Domänens DNS-namn sträng
name Namnet på identitetskällan sträng
password Lösenordet för Active Directory-användaren med minst skrivskyddad åtkomst till Base DN för användare och grupper. sträng
primaryServer URL för primär server sträng
secondaryServer URL för sekundär server sträng
Ssl Skydda LDAP-kommunikation med SSL-certifikat (LDAPS) "Inaktiverad"
"Aktiverad"
användarnamn ID för en Active Directory-användare med minst skrivskyddad åtkomst till bas-DN för användare och grupper sträng

ManagementCluster

Namn Beskrivning Värde
clusterSize Klusterstorleken int

Sku

Namn Beskrivning Värde
name Namnet på SKU:n. sträng (krävs)

Resursdefinition för Terraform (AzAPI-provider)

Resurstypen privateClouds kan distribueras med åtgärder som är mål:

  • Resursgrupper

En lista över ändrade egenskaper i varje API-version finns i ändringsloggen.

Resursformat

Om du vill skapa en Microsoft.AVS/privateClouds-resurs lägger du till följande Terraform i mallen.

resource "azapi_resource" "symbolicname" {
  type = "Microsoft.AVS/privateClouds@2020-03-20"
  name = "string"
  location = "string"
  parent_id = "string"
  tags = {
    tagName1 = "tagValue1"
    tagName2 = "tagValue2"
  }
  body = jsonencode({
    properties = {
      circuit = {}
      identitySources = [
        {
          alias = "string"
          baseGroupDN = "string"
          baseUserDN = "string"
          domain = "string"
          name = "string"
          password = "string"
          primaryServer = "string"
          secondaryServer = "string"
          ssl = "string"
          username = "string"
        }
      ]
      internet = "string"
      managementCluster = {
        clusterSize = int
      }
      networkBlock = "string"
      nsxtPassword = "string"
      vcenterPassword = "string"
    }
    sku = {
      name = "string"
    }
  })
}

Egenskapsvärden

privateClouds

Namn Beskrivning Värde
typ Resurstypen "Microsoft.AVS/privateClouds@2020-03-20"
name Resursnamnet sträng (krävs)
location Resursplats sträng
parent_id Om du vill distribuera till en resursgrupp använder du ID:t för den resursgruppen. sträng (krävs)
tags Resurstaggar Ordlista med taggnamn och värden.
sku SKU:n för privata moln SKU (krävs)
properties Egenskaperna för en privat molnresurs PrivateCloudProperties (krävs)

PrivateCloudProperties

Namn Beskrivning Värde
Krets En ExpressRoute-krets Krets
identitySources vCenter Enkel inloggning identitetskällor IdentitySource[]
Internet Anslutning till Internet är aktiverad eller inaktiverad "Inaktiverad"
"Aktiverad"
managementCluster Standardklustret som används för hantering ManagementCluster
networkBlock Adressblocket ska vara unikt för det virtuella nätverket i din prenumeration och lokalt. Kontrollera att CIDR-formatet överensstämmer med (A.B.C.D/X) där A,B,C,D är mellan 0 och 255 och X är mellan 0 och 22 sträng (krävs)
nsxtPassword Du kan också ange NSX-T Manager-lösenordet när det privata molnet skapas sträng
vcenterPassword Du kan också ange vCenter-administratörslösenordet när det privata molnet skapas sträng

Krets

Det här objektet innehåller inga egenskaper som ska anges under distributionen. Alla egenskaper är ReadOnly.

IdentitySource

Namn Beskrivning Värde
alias Domänens NetBIOS-namn sträng
baseGroupDN Det unika basnamnet för grupper sträng
baseUserDN Det unika basnamnet för användare sträng
domän Domänens dns-namn sträng
name Namnet på identitetskällan sträng
password Lösenordet för Active Directory-användaren med minst skrivskyddad åtkomst till Base DN för användare och grupper. sträng
primaryServer Primär server-URL sträng
secondaryServer Sekundär server-URL sträng
Ssl Skydda LDAP-kommunikation med SSL-certifikat (LDAPS) "Inaktiverad"
"Aktiverad"
användarnamn ID för en Active Directory-användare med minst skrivskyddad åtkomst till Base DN för användare och grupper sträng

ManagementCluster

Namn Beskrivning Värde
clusterSize Klusterstorleken int

Sku

Namn Beskrivning Värde
name Namnet på SKU:n. sträng (krävs)